Bind has that as well with 'ndc', and apache with apachectl.
Such helper scripts are indeed very useful, and it owuld be quite
nice to have them for the standard subsystems -- I found find
it far more convenient to type eg 'amdc restart' instead of
'killall amd && . /etc/rc.conf && amd -p ${amd_flags}' :)
